ततः संपूजयेद्देवं ब्रह्माणं बालरूपिणम् । एवं रौद्री समाख्याता यात्रा पातकनाशिनी
tataḥ saṃpūjayeddevaṃ brahmāṇaṃ bālarūpiṇam | evaṃ raudrī samākhyātā yātrā pātakanāśinī
پھر بال رُوپ دھارن کرنے والے دیوتا برہما کی پوری طرح پوجا کرے۔ یوں ‘رَودری’ نامی یاترا بیان کی گئی ہے، جو گناہوں کو نَشت کرنے والی ہے۔
